Transaction 65fe56ead5959b06b8dce98a90d8d326395d2c74b1a9f31e5d6650078320ae76
2 Input
2 Outputs
- 65fe56ead5959b06b8dce98a90d8d326395d2c74b1a9f31e5d6650078320ae76:0
- 65fe56ead5959b06b8dce98a90d8d326395d2c74b1a9f31e5d6650078320ae76:1
value 208239
address 13vamv5zNUPAmWp5Kv5SARhXPWAc4sMDVw
value 1880
address 1Hu5zphvtbcgvM97S5CyknNWygafDCUHSN